On 2026/3/6 16:57, Nithurshen w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> This patch series introduces two minor improvements to the erofs-utils tools:
> 
> 1. dump.erofs: Removes a redundant conditional branch in the filesize distribution output logic to clean up the code.
> 2. fsck.erofs: Adds a warning message when encountering an unsupported file type during extraction, rather than silently skipping it.
Those patches looks good, but each line in the commit messages
is too long.

They should be no more than 72-char instead.
